INTERNATIONAL FINANCE. You are evaluating investments in U.S. equities and Mexican equities. Your stock analysts anticipate that U.S. equities will appreciate 9% over the next year. The Mexican equities are expected to rise 15%. Your foreign exchange analyst expects the exchange rate for Mexican pesos, MP, to change from $.14286/MP to $.142015/MP. What rate of return do you expect to earn on the Mexican equities? Note: be sure to convert all values to USD before calculating the percentage return.
